
Jaguar Land Rover is on a mission to transform the way we listen to music in cars and it has announced a collaboration with Spotify, a music streaming service, to offer an app with readily available ‘music for every moment’ radio and personalised playlists based on users’ tastes and in-car listening habits. Musicians Ricky Wilson from Kaiser Chiefs and Elliot Gleave, aka Example, were the first to try the app in the car before its official release, going head to head in a battle of music tastes.
Example said, “It’s great to be the first to try the new Spotify app in a Jaguar. It worked really well and I had fun setting up my winning playlist and chatting with Ricky, even if I did have to listen to his jokes.”
Ricky said, “I listen to music every day so it’s important I’m now able to use the app while I’m on the move. I respect Elliot’s music tastes, we’d even both included Jamie T, but my playlist was the best by miles.”
Both created a Spotify playlist featuring their top driving songs and took to the road in the new Range Rover Evoque Convertible and the Jaguar XE to pitch their playlists against one another.
